Donauland to change to Wagram

The Donauland wine-growing region in Austria will be changing its name to Wagram in future.
After lengthy discussions, the decision has been taken to change the name of the Donauland wine-growing region in Lower Austria to Wagram. Ever since 1995, the Donauland has consisted of the sub-regions of Wagram (around 2.500 hectares located north of the Danube) and Klosterneuburg (around 350 hectares located to the south of the river), however the name was bever really popular. In recent years, an increasing number of wine producers has sought to buld up a profile under the Wagram name, with the designation Donauland becoming an almost superfluous appendage. A new regional site (Grosslage) Klosterneuburg has been created within the new Wagram region. The new designation will apply as of the 2007 vintage.
